The Digital Building Fabrication Laboratory (DBFL) was completed in 2016. It represents the foundation for future research in the field of digital fabrication at the Institute of Structural Design (ITE) and the Technical University of Braunschweig. The aim of the DBFL is to use robot-controlled production processes to combine the latest findings in materials technology with innovative design ideas in order to develop resource-efficient load-bearing structures in the construction industry.
